One of Portugal's largest seaports, Leixoes is just 8 kilometers from the heart of Porto, where the city shares its name with one of the country's best-known exports, Port wine. Located at the mouth of the Douro River, Porto is a UNESCO World Heritage-listed city of Baroque splendor, Gothic cathedrals, and incredible food. Wander through winding alleys lined with houses decorated with Portuguese tiles, see the city's street art, and take in the views from the cable car and funicular. Ferrol, Spain
Start your day relaxing in your suite. Ask your butler to bring you breakfast in bed or alternatively, choose to savor it in the Yacht Club before arriving in Ferrol. Explore the boutiques and Galician-style houses in Ferrol's Magdalena neighborhood, a declared Historic-Artistic Site, and visit the 18th-century San Felipe Castle, where bulwarks and cannons defended the city. Aviles, Spain
Sailing into Aviles, you'll be greeted by stunning views of the picturesque harbor and its beautiful blend of medieval and modern architecture. The city's old town, or Casco Antiguo, features a range of well-preserved medieval buildings and streets. Highlights include the Plaza del Carbayedo, a charming square home to a lively weekly market. For a deeper dive into the region's heritage, explore nearby Oviedo, a UNESCO World Heritage Site renowned for its rich history and stunning architecture. Bilbao, Spain
Today, you'll explore Bilbao, deemed one of the Basque Country jewels. This vibrant city is famous for its striking modern architecture, home to the iconic Guggenheim Museum Bilbao, which showcases contemporary art and is a must-visit attraction. Bilbao also boasts a rich cultural heritage, which can be experienced by visiting landmarks such as the Basilica de Begona and the Casco Viejo, or the charming old town. Belle-lle-en-Mer, France
One of France's most beautiful islands, Belle-Ile boasts a lush countryside, jagged rocky coastlines, quaint seaside hamlets, and pastel-colored homes. It is a mythical destination that has long inspired sailors, authors like Flaubert and Dumas, and painters like Claude Monet and Matisse. This pristine location can only be accessed by boat, which means that mainstream tourists are few and far between. Explore the islands rich history and gain a new appreciation of its natural beauty.
